Feasibility Studies for Light Scattering Experiments to Determine the Velocity Relaxation of Small Particles in a Fluid

机译:光散射实验确定流体中小颗粒速度弛豫的可行性研究

获取原文

摘要

An approach for measuring the non-Markoffian component in the relaxation mechanism of a Brownian particle is proposed which combines desirable features of both the shock wave experiment and conventional light scattering experiments. It is suggested that the radiation pressure generated by a C.W. laser be used to guide an individual spherical particle to terminal velocity. At an appropriate time, the beam intensity is suddenly lowered to a value at which the radiation pressure is negligible, and the ensuing velocity relaxation is measured directly.
